Ibuprofen is a well-known nonsteroidal anti-inflammatory drug, which can interact with lipid membranes. In this paper, the interaction of ibuprofen with bilayer lipid membrane was studied by UV–vis spectroscopy, cyclic voltammetry and AC impedance spectroscopy. The interaction of chlorpromazine (CPZ) with supported bilayer lipid (dipalmitoyphosphatidylcholine) membrane (s-BLM) on the glassy carbon electrode (GCE) was investigated using cyclic voltammetry and ac impedance spectroscopy.
